Output 01626983ebb19f5e988cd764f48e648fc37dcfea2256aaa6104708d320d20036:3

value
21772746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c52883926196496beebef6f90a0ff01426894bf OP_EQUAL
address
MSXWwzifzy8mE9sVZpczLBoXThhD8cabca
transaction
01626983ebb19f5e988cd764f48e648fc37dcfea2256aaa6104708d320d20036
spent
true